I have been have pain as well, they have taken blood test to see if there is any inflammation in my system, there was. Now I am awaiting to see a rheumatologist. They are doctors that specialize in arthritis and related disease. Maybe you should see if your primary doctor will give you a referral to see a rheumatologist. He may want to do lab test first.

Shoulder pain is an extremely common complaint that has many causes. Because we use our arms for so many common activities, shoulder pain can cause significant problems. In order for proper treatment, the cause of the problem must be identified.
